Description
Are you ready to explore an exciting chance in the metal recycling industry? We are seeking a Truck Driver to join our dynamic team and play a key role in our operations, ensuring metal materials are transported safely. As a Truck Driver, your transportation expertise will drive our success. Your commitment to quality work and reliability will make you an essential part of our team.

Schedule:
This is a Permanent, Full-Time position Monday to Friday from 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. , with the potential for overtime as required.

Key Responsibilities:

Truck & Trailer Inspection:
Inspect truck and trailer units to identify any mechanical issues or safety concerns, ensuring the vehicles are always roadworthy.

Preventative Maintenance:
Perform routine preventative maintenance on equipment to ensure optimal performance and avoid breakdowns.

Safety Program Participation:
Actively participate in and promote the company’s safety program, ensuring a safe work environment for yourself and others.

Truck Cab Cleanliness:




Maintain a clean and organized truck cab at all times, following internal and external cleaning procedures.

Equipment Operation: Safely operate various company units, including but not limited to: Tractor Units
Lugger Trucks
Flat Deck Trucks
Super B High Side Trailers
Roll-off Units
Dump Trailers

Qualifications:
A minimum of 2 years of extensive driving experience utilizing a class 1A license.
Manual Transmission Experience.
Holds a clean driver's abstract.
